I played it a lot back in the day. Me and Randy (Flyermania) started our "modding career" together from NHL 2001.

Brings back a lot of memories.

However, it can't be compared to NHL 04 modded... or the current console hockey games (NHL 15, etc). It's clearly a game from the "older gaming generation". Time hasn't been very gentle to it.

But definitely a nice pick if you can get it for cheap. I loved it back in the day and played/modded it to death.

Big hits gave a "momentum boost" (there was a momentum meter) and occasionally it was complete mayhem on ice. :D

Stupidest thing was the 360 somersault after a big hit. Community fixed it though (Bruno's patch).

Nice 2-player game but against the CPU it was wayyyyyy too easy. I tweaked my own team abilities all the way down to 50 and still won the Cup on hardest level.

2001 had Jim Hughson and Bill Clement.
2002 and 2003, Don Taylor replaced Bill Clement.
2004 and on Craig Simpson replaced Don Taylor
